Job DetailsLevel: ExperiencedJob Location: Central - Waco, TX 76707Position Type: Full TimeEducation Level: 4 Year DegreeJob Shift: DayJob Category: NursePRIMARY DUTIES  Perform comprehensive telephonic and electronic nursing assessments to evaluate patient symptoms and determine appropriate level of care   Utilize standardized triage protocols and clinical judgment to guide care recommendations (e.g., home care, same-day visit, urgent/emergent care)   Facilitate one-call resolution whenever appropriate, reducing unnecessary follow-up and in-basket messaging   Document all patient interactions accurately and efficiently in the EHR   Escalate complex or high-risk cases to providers or appropriate care settings   Coordinate same-day or next-day appointments based on clinical need   Manage and respond to in-basket messages, lab results, and patient inquiries within established turnaround times   Provide patient education, including symptom management, medication guidance, and follow-up care instructions   Support population health initiatives by identifying care gaps and facilitating appropriate interventions     OTHER DUTIES  Serve as a clinical resource for CMAs, LVNs, and other care team members   Collaborate with providers and interdisciplinary teams to optimize workflows and patient outcomes   Participate in quality improvement initiatives related to access, triage efficiency, and patient safety   Assist in development and refinement of triage protocols and workflows   Participate in orientation, training, and competency validation activities   Maintain compliance with all organizational policies, regulatory requirements, and clinical standards   Perform other duties as assigned    Qualifications Registered Nurse (RN) – Triage & Care Coordination    REPORTS TO: Regional Director of Nursing/Practice Manager      POSITION SUMMARY    The RN Phone Triage Nurse provides remote clinical assessment, triage, and care coordination for patients through telephone and electronic communication platforms. This role utilizes evidence-based protocols, clinical judgment, and critical thinking skills to determine appropriate levels of care, promote one-call resolution, and reduce unnecessary in-basket burden for providers and clinic staff. The RN serves as a key clinical decision-maker, ensuring safe, timely, and patient-centered care delivery in alignment with organizational standards.  Bilingual (Spanish/English) candidates and experience with Epic are strongly preferred.    RE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S  Active Registered Nurse (RN) license in the state of Texas   Minimum of 1 year of inpatient clinical experience   Strong clinical assessment and critical thinking skills   Experience with electronic health records (EHR); Epic preferred   Excellent communication and patient education skills   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team    P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S  Bilingual (Spanish/English)   Experience in ambulatory care, triage, or nurse call center environments   Familiarity with evidence-based triage protocols (e.g., Schmitt-Thompson)     SKILLS & COMPETENCIES  Advanced clinical assessment and triage decision-making   Strong critical thinking and problem-solving abilities   Ability to prioritize and manage high-volume patient communication   Effective patient education and motivational communication   Proficiency in EHR documentation and in-basket management   Care coordination and interdisciplinary collaboration   Leadership and ability to support clinical team members    PHYSICAL AND MENTAL REQUIREMENTS  Ability to work in an indoor, office-based or remote setting   Prolonged periods of sitting with frequent computer and telephone use   Continuous verbal communication and active listening   Ability to multitask, prioritize, and respond quickly in high-volume situations   Strong attention to detail and ability to interpret clinical information accurately   Ability to remain calm and exercise sound judgment in urgent or emergent situations   Occasional minimal lifting (up to 15 lbs.)
